### Host-only Network IP - Command-line static variant

An alternative is to edit `/etc/sysconfig/network-scripts/ifcfg-eth$j` (j=1 usually) with:
```
i=1 # node id
j=1 # eth id - double-check with ifconfig

echo "
DEVICE=eth$j
ONBOOT=yes
NAME=lan
IPADDR=192.168.56.10{$i}
NETMASK=255.255.255.0
NETWORK=192.168.56.0
BROADCAST=192.168.56.255
GATEWAY=192.168.56.0
NM_CONTROLLED=no
" > /etc/sysconfig/network-scripts/ifcfg-eth$j

service NetworkManager stop
chkconfig --level 123456 NetworkManager off
```

### Couchbase-specific setup
```
# This defaults to 60
cat /proc/sys/
vm
/swappiness
# This disables it for the running system
echo 0 > /proc/sys/vm/swappiness
echo '' >> /etc/sysctl.conf
echo '#Set swappiness to 0 to avoid swapping' >> /etc/sysctl.conf
echo 'vm.swappiness = 0' >> /etc/sysctl.conf

#Disable firewall (again?)
chkconfig --level 123456 iptables off
```

## Nodes 2 and 3

* right-click your VM in VirtualBox main window anc click "Clone -> Full Clone, Refresh MAC address", to create the nodes 2 and 3.

* modify the Port forwarding rules
```
for i in 2 3; do
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 delete "guest1-SSH"
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 "guest${i}-SSH,tcp,,9${i}22,,22"
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 delete "guest1-CB"
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 "guest${i}-CB,tcp,,9${i}91,,8091"
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 delete "guest1-VNC"
VBoxManage modifyvm "CentOS6-DCCPW-Node$i" --natpf1 "guest${i}-VNC,tcp,,9${i}59,,5901"
done
```

* Make sure that MAC adresses have been randomize in Network settings

* Boot them *in the right order*

* Double-check that NetworkManager has done its job: `ifconfig` should tell you the host-only adapter IPs are ...102 and ...103
